How to write an art essay Examining Creativity The thing that makes an art paper different than any other writing assignment you may encounter may also present you with your greatest writing challenges: Essentially, your task is to use words to explain images.

From the beginning of learning how to write an art essay, you must be able to grapple with the language of the craft — you must be knowledgeable of the terms and precepts if Structure of art essay to learn how to write an art essay.

More significantly, when you are have become skilled at the task of how to write an art essay, you will be able to properly describe the image before you but also to offer a complete description, offering a valid defence for your perspective of the art.

Your paper cannot contain just a random description of the various aspects of the artwork, whether it is a sculpture, building or painting.

You need to know exactly what you will say regarding your particular topic, using your ability to both analyse accurately and to properly describe the artwork which you have selected to describe.

Types of Art Writings If you following the writings of Sylvan Barnet, you will see that he has identified five primary types of art papers. Of course, if the assignment is at your discretion you may chose to utilise these writing types as a means of brainstorming or exploring the some ideas for the topic of your assignment.

The Sociological Essay examines a specific era in history and suggests how that particular era may have influenced the topic of your discussion.

It is possible that your discussion will also raise some more generalised questions regarding social influences, including such topics as the impact of economics on the art, the challenges facing woman seeking recognition in the field, and so on.

Image Writing better known as iconography is the type of writing that chooses to define images through the in depth exploration of the various symbols noted in an artwork selection. Use of lines — Did the artist use heavy or light lines? Do the lines run vertically or horizontally? Are the lines curved or straight? Is there a specific goal or outcome achieved by the use of these lines? Coloration — Does the artist use realistic colours, or are the colours more expressive in nature?

Does the colour give the sense of being warm or cool? Perhaps the colours are bright or subdued. If so, what is the overall effect of those colours? Light — How does the artist employ light? Does the artist use shadows?

What is the arrangement of the shapes used within the space of the work? How might that use of space influence your own response to the art? Composition — Are there any formal aspects or elements of the work which interact with each other? Does the composition of the work convey the theme or idea of the artwork?

Does it make your eye travel in a consistent manner across the piece of art? Does the composition of the art influence that movement? One must always examine the context of the work.

Consider when the work was painted, who is the artist and where was the work completed? How have culture or history influenced the work? Does it address any specific historical or cultural matters? As you are learning how to write an art essay, consider writing down questions that you may chose to answer within the scope of your essay.

These questions will likely guide your examination of existing library sources. You may also desire to examine and keep any documentation or brochures that the gallery or museum may have available.
